dc.description | We present ozone volume mixing ratio profiles obtained by the ORA instrument during the period Aug 1992-Apr 1993. They have been retrieved by applying a specific inversion algorithm to a radiometric UV channel contaminated by Rayleigh scattering. The results compare reasonably well with other instruments up to the mesopause and are probably the first extended ozone data in the lower thermosphere (90-110 km). | |
